When considering alternative fuel options for commercial vehicles, LNG (Liquefied Natural Gas) and CNG (Compressed Natural Gas) are two of the most popular choices. Both fuels provide cleaner, cost-effective alternatives to traditional diesel, with benefits for the environment and operational costs. However, LNG and CNG trucks have distinct differences in terms of storage, range, fueling, and infrastructure needs, making each more suited to different applications.
Here's a detailed comparison between LNG and CNG trucks, which will help you understand their respective benefits:
| Aspect | LNG Trucks | CNG Trucks |
|---|---|---|
| Fuel Type | Liquefied Natural Gas (LNG) | Compressed Natural Gas (CNG) |
| Storage Method | Stored as a liquid under cryogenic conditions (−162°C) | Stored as a gas under high pressure (3,000–3,600 psi) |
| Energy Density | Higher energy density due to liquid state | Lower energy density than LNG due to gas state |
| Range | Longer range, ideal for long-haul trucking | Shorter range, ideal for city-based and regional fleets |
| Refueling Time | Slower refueling due to cryogenic storage requirements | Faster refueling compared to LNG |
| Vehicle Design & Cost | Higher upfront costs, larger and more complex design | Lower upfront costs, smaller and simpler design |
| Infrastructure Availability | Limited infrastructure along highways, but growing | More widespread infrastructure, especially in urban areas |
| Fuel Availability | Suitable for long-haul, interstate routes with larger stations | More suitable for city fleets and short-range routes |
| Environmental Impact | Lower CO2 emissions compared to CNG due to higher energy content | Lower emissions than diesel, but higher CO2 than LNG |
LNG (Liquefied Natural Gas):
LNG is natural gas that has been liquefied by cooling it to extremely low temperatures (around −162°C / −260°F). This allows for high-energy density storage, meaning LNG trucks can carry more fuel in a smaller space. LNG trucks are best for long-distance trucking, as they provide more fuel efficiency for long-haul routes.
CNG (Compressed Natural Gas):
CNG is natural gas that is compressed to high pressures (around 3,000–3,600 psi), making it suitable for storage in pressurized tanks. The gas remains at normal temperatures but requires more space for the same energy content, which is why CNG trucks are typically used for short-range, urban deliveries.
LNG Trucks:
Due to LNG’s higher energy density, LNG trucks offer a longer driving range compared to CNG trucks. This makes them an excellent option for long-haul routes or regions with fewer refueling stations. They are ideal for high-mileage operations.
CNG Trucks:
CNG trucks generally offer shorter range than LNG trucks due to their lower energy density. They are typically used for regional or city-based fleets, where refueling stations are more accessible and the routes are not as long.
LNG Trucks:
LNG trucks are best suited for areas with larger LNG refueling stations, usually located along highways or in regions where long-haul trucking is common. Refueling can take longer due to the cryogenic process, but it is ideal for operations that require infrequent refueling.
CNG Trucks:
CNG refueling stations are more widely available in urban areas, making CNG trucks suitable for city fleets. Refueling is quicker compared to LNG, making it convenient for operations that need frequent refueling.
LNG Trucks:
LNG trucks typically have higher upfront costs due to the cryogenic storage tanks required for liquefied natural gas. These trucks also tend to be larger and more complex due to the specialized infrastructure needed to manage the low temperatures of LNG.
CNG Trucks:
CNG trucks generally have lower upfront costs and simpler designs. The smaller storage tanks required for CNG are easier to integrate into trucks and generally involve less complexity than LNG systems.
Both LNG and CNG trucks provide significant environmental benefits over diesel-powered vehicles, including reductions in CO₂ emissions, NOx, and particulate matter (PM). However, LNG trucks tend to have slightly lower CO₂ emissions due to the higher energy density of LNG compared to CNG. This makes LNG an excellent choice for fleets looking to minimize their carbon footprint over longer distances.
When deciding between LNG and CNG trucks, consider these factors based on your fleet's operational needs:
For long-haul trucking or interstate routes, LNG trucks are often the better choice due to their greater fuel efficiency and range.
For city-based fleets or short-range operations, CNG trucks may be more suitable due to their widespread refueling infrastructure and lower operational costs.
If your fleet operates in areas with limited refueling infrastructure, LNG trucks might be more beneficial for longer trips, while CNG trucks can serve urban environments more effectively.
